Moth and Gloss's Story
Moth (more red on her) and Gloss were surrendered by their owners because they were just 4-H projects and the kids didn't get attached to them and didn't want them anymore. Both girls are fairly calm when being picked up, but they seem to like being held. They will need a little time to adjust to a new home, as they haven't been in the rescue very long.
